Dell announces the new Alienware and Dell G Series Gaming Laptops

The company has announced several new products, including notebooks designed for gamers. It starts from inexpensive models for those who are less demanding, up to real desktop replacement without compromise and GPU GeForce GTX 1080.

Dell has just launched several products, simultaneously updating the line-up of laptops designed for gaming. Among these are the new Alienware 15R4 and Alienware 17R5 aimed, as usual for the brand, for those who want to throw themselves headlong into the world of video games without compromise.

The new models make use of Intel Core 8th generation processors up to the Core i9 models, and aim to be the most powerful laptops ever designed by the company. They adopt improved thermal solutions compared to the past, within a design with the lowest possible thickness.

The shell is made of aluminum, magnesium alloy and reinforced steel parts, while the accessibility to the internal components has been simplified with a new mechanism that can be opened at the bottom.

The design for the speakers integrated with the smart-amp is also improved, while all the configurations adopt network adapters Killer Networks e2500 Gigabit Ethernet and Killer 1550 Networks 802.11ac 2×2 with support for Bluetooth 5.0. Along the chassis, there are three USB 3.0 ports, one with PowerShare technology, and another Type-C port for reversible connectors.

New Alienware 15R4 and 17R5 Gaming Laptops

Alienware 15R4 uses in the basic version the Intel Core i5-8300HQ, while variants will also be available with Intel Core i7-8750H and Core i9-8950HQ. The latter two 6-core processors are the only ones available on the 17″ version.

The 15R4 model uses 15.6″ displays in two different versions: a Full HD Tn with a maximum refresh rate of 120 Hz, the other IPS 4K Ultra HD with IPS matrix. As for the model Alienware 17R5 we find two panels, both 17.3″ : one Tn with refresh rate of 120 Hz at Quad HD resolution, the other instead IPS with 4K resolution and 60 Hz refresh rate.

On the GPU, we find both AMD solutions (with Radeon RX570 and 8 GB of dedicated GDDR5 RAM) and NVIDIA. In the latter case, versions with GeForce GTX 1060, GTX 1070 and GTX 1080 with 6 and 8 GB of dedicated DGGR5 RAM can be purchased.

On the memory side, laptops are equipped with 8 to 32 GB of RAM and different storage solutions, either SSD S-ATA or PCIe M.2, HDD or hybrid. Do not miss the dual and triple storage configurations to get the best out of the different worlds.

The new Alienware laptops will be available on the market by the end of April 2018 at a price of 1450 and 1600 dollars respectively for the 15 and 17-inch basic variants with G-Sync, while 1400 and 1550 for those without G-support. Sync.

New Dell G Series Gaming Laptops

Together with the new branded laptops, Alienware Dell announced the new G Series family products. It starts naturally with the Dell G3 15 and Dell G3 17, which use a compact design and eighth-generation Intel Core processors and N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060 GPUs with Max-Q technology.

Both models use the same hardware features and differ mainly in terms of display size and general: panels are IPS and maintain support for native Full HD resolution. Those who want to spend less can opt for the GeForce GTX 1050 and 1050 Ti GPU solutions, while Dual Drive configurations, with HDD and also SSD, both SATA and PCIe are available.

Dell G3 15 LaptopsLaptops also implement 4 to 32 GB of RAM depending on the version. On the connectivity front there are Wi-Fi ac, optional Bluetooth 5.0, an HDMI 2.0 port, two USB SuperSpeed ​​3.1, an optional Type-C with support for Thunderbolt 3, and Gigabit Ethernet. Very interesting prices for basic versions: $749 for the 15-inch model, 799 for the 17-inch model.

Also at $799, we find the basic model of the Dell G5 15 variant, which can implement Full HD or 4K panels, both IPS, inside a 15″ diagonal. This product is equipped with Intel Core i5-8300HQ or i7- 8750HQ, up to 16 GB of RAM (maximum of 32 GB can be installed) and different storage solutions similar to those of the G3 family.

The video cards can also be in this case three, all NVIDIA: GeForce GTX 1050, GTX 1050 Ti and GTX 1060 with Max-Q, to mention the presence of Killer networks and the MaxxAudio Pro system to improve the sound output.

The latest model in the family is the Dell G7 15, available in the same period at a base price of $849 and also with optional Intel Core i9 CPU. The GPU of the solution at the top of the range remains, also in this case, a GTX 1060 with Max-Q.
